Merck & Co., Inc. is a global pharmaceutical and biotech company headquartered in Kenilworth, New Jersey. Beyond drugs like Keytruda and Januvia, Merck has expanded into digital health, AI‑driven drug discovery, and precision medicine. The company’s research labs integrate advanced data analytics to accelerate clinical trials and develop next‑generation therapeutics.

Merck’s tech hiring focuses on data science, software engineering, AI research, and product management across its R&D, manufacturing, and commercial divisions. Candidates can expect algorithm‑based coding challenges, domain‑specific case studies, and collaborative teamwork that reflects Merck’s emphasis on scientific rigor and patient impact. The interview process typically includes a technical screen, a live coding session, and a behavioral panel that evaluates problem‑solving, communication, and ethical decision‑making.

Frequently Asked Questions

What’s it like to work at Merck?
Working at Merck means collaborating with scientists, clinicians, and data experts to deliver life‑changing therapies. Employees value the company’s commitment to research excellence, benefit packages that include health, wellness, and retirement plans, and a culture that encourages continuous learning. Leadership promotes cross‑functional projects, providing opportunities to impact product development from discovery to commercialization.
What tech positions are available at Merck?
Merck hires a wide range of tech roles: Data Scientists, Machine Learning Engineers, Software Engineers (backend, frontend, full stack), DevOps Specialists, Cloud Architects, AI Researchers, Product Managers, Clinical Informatics Analysts, and Cybersecurity Engineers. Positions span R&D labs, manufacturing IT, and commercial digital platforms like the Merck Digital Health Group.
How can I stand out as a Merck applicant?
Show domain‑specific expertise—demonstrate knowledge of bioinformatics, clinical data, or pharma software. Build a portfolio with projects that solve real‑world problems, such as analyzing clinical trial data or optimizing supply‑chain logistics. During interviews, prepare for both coding challenges and scenario‑based questions that test ethical decision‑making in a regulated industry. Highlight your ability to collaborate across disciplines and your commitment to innovation and patient outcomes.
